Are student loans allowed in Islam and what to do if family insists on taking one?

Answered as per Hanafi Fiqh by Muftisays.com
salaamz

just wondering if student loans are allowed in Islam. also what do i do if family members insist i take out a student loan?

jazakallah khair

Answer
Bismihi Ta’ala

Student loans in the UK are not permissible in Islam. Although it is commonly known that its not given on an interest basis, rather the repayment is according to the inflation. It is still Riba regardless of what perspective it is observed from.

You must strongly oppose your family if they insist you take it. Explain to them that it is Riba, which is an explicit and clear prohibition in Islam. May Allah help you.
